Dalkia UK are looking for a full time HR Advisor to join our HR team on a 12 month fixed term contract. This role will support sites on a national scale and will require frequent travel.

Main Activities

  • You will be an integral member of the operational HR team, proactively supporting the HR Business Partner to deliver professional and timely generalist advice and guidance to managers and employees within the FM business.

Main Duties and Responsibilities

  • Employee Relations Support: Disciplinary, Grievance, Harassment and Discrimination casework.
  • Recruitment & Selection: Coordinate the internal and external process, liaising with the internal recruitment team, agencies and supporting the interview process through to induction and probation.
  • Service Delivery: Build and maintain effective working relationships with all levels of management and functions to provide robust management information/data. Provide expert guidance to line management and employees to ensure adoption of effective and consistent working HR practices, to include lawful compliance and adherence to company policy and procedure.
  • Absence: Assisting with the management of short and long term absence, in line with company standards, including working with external Occupational Health providers and making home visits.
  • Performance: Working with managers to address performance improvements, setting SMART objectives and assisting with the annual Performance Development Review (PDR) Process.
  • Learning and Talent: To assist with training programmes, deliver manager upskilling sessions and work with managers to identify development areas/activities to support individual personal development plans. Support of Apprenticeships programmes, coordinate reviews and work rotations.
  • Project work: To assist with specific project work to contribute towards HR objectives to ensure continuous improvement.
  • CPD: To develop yourself and keep abreast with developments in the HR profession.

Please note that this is not an exhaustive list and you may be required to assist the HR Business Partner with other duties as appropriate.
